Navigating Hyaluronic Acid Injections for Knee Osteoarthritis

Hyaluronic acid injections may be a valuable treatment option for individuals experiencing the discomfort and limitations of knee osteoarthritis. These injections work by supplying a lubricant to the joint space, which supports in reducing friction and inflammation. Individuals who consider hyaluronic acid injections should consult their healthcare professional to determine if it is an appropriate treatment choice for them. The process involves a series of injections administered directly into the knee joint, and while there are potential side effects such as pain or swelling at the injection site, most individuals experience significant reduction in symptoms.
